探索GitHub高星项目中的第二贡献者

引言

在开源社区中,GitHub是最受欢迎的平台之一,尤其是其中的高星项目更是吸引了无数开发者的目光。本文将深入探讨这些高星项目的第二贡献者,分析他们在项目中所扮演的重要角色,以及他们如何影响整个开源生态。

什么是高星项目?

高星项目通常是指在GitHub上拥有大量星标(stars)的开源项目。这些项目通常是:

  • 具有广泛的应用性
  • 被积极维护
  • 有良好的文档支持
  • 有活跃的社区

第二贡献者的定义

第二贡献者是指在一个项目中,贡献代码或文档的开发者,但其贡献量通常位于第一贡献者之后。尽管他们的贡献量可能不如第一贡献者显著,但他们对项目的影响同样重要。

为什么第二贡献者重要?

第二贡献者通常对项目有以下几方面的影响:

  1. 多样性
    • 第二贡献者带来不同的观点和解决方案,有助于项目的创新和完善。
  2. 降低依赖性
    • 如果第一贡献者无法继续维护项目,第二贡献者可以帮助继续推进项目的发展。
  3. 丰富的经验
    • 第二贡献者通常拥有丰富的经验和技能,这对项目的质量提升至关重要。

如何找到第二贡献者

寻找高星项目的第二贡献者可以通过以下几种方式:

  • 查看项目的贡献者列表
    • 在GitHub项目页面中,点击“贡献者”可以查看所有贡献者的详细信息,包括提交次数。
  • 分析提交历史
    • 使用Git命令如git log来分析提交历史,从中识别出第二贡献者。
  • 使用第三方工具
    • 有一些工具和网站可以帮助分析GitHub项目的贡献者,甚至可以按贡献量排序。

第二贡献者的成功案例

以下是一些高星项目中的成功第二贡献者案例:

  • 项目A
    • 贡献者B为该项目的文档部分做出了显著贡献,帮助了更多用户理解如何使用该项目。
  • 项目C
    • 贡献者D通过添加新功能,提高了项目的实用性,并积极参与项目讨论。

如何成为高星项目的第二贡献者

若您希望成为一个高星项目的第二贡献者,可以遵循以下步骤:

  1. 选择一个感兴趣的项目
    • 查找您感兴趣的高星项目。
  2. 熟悉项目
    • 阅读文档、查看问题和功能请求。
  3. 积极参与
    • 在问题区或讨论区提问或回答问题。
  4. 提交代码或文档改进
    • 提交Pull Request,向项目贡献您的代码或改进。

常见问题解答 (FAQ)

1. 第二贡献者的角色是什么?

第二贡献者在项目中扮演着非常重要的角色,他们通常为项目贡献新特性、修复bug、编写文档等。尽管他们的贡献量可能较少,但对于项目的成长和维护却至关重要。

2. 如何判断一个项目的第二贡献者?

可以通过项目的贡献者列表和提交历史来判断第二贡献者。查看他们的提交记录和影响力,能更好地了解他们的贡献。

3. 高星项目的选择标准是什么?

选择高星项目时,可以考虑项目的活跃程度、社区支持、文档质量和实际应用案例等。星标数虽然是一个指标,但并不是唯一标准。

4. 成为第二贡献者有什么好处?

作为第二贡献者,您不仅能提高自己的技术能力,还能扩大人脉和影响力,甚至可能获得相关行业的认可。

5. 如何鼓励其他开发者成为第二贡献者?

通过分享项目的价值和潜在的学习机会,积极参与社区讨论,并欢迎其他开发者的贡献,可以有效鼓励他们参与到项目中来。

总结

在高星项目中,第二贡献者虽然往往不如第一贡献者显眼,但他们的贡献对项目的成功和持续发展至关重要。希望本文能帮助您更好地理解GitHub高星项目中的第二贡献者,并激励更多开发者积极参与开源贡献。

正文完